Ingredients List
Here’s what you’ll need to create this gorgeous dessert plating:
- 1 chocolate cake – 1 piece, baked and cooled to perfection
- 1 cup whipped cream, light and fluffy (chill it for that perfect texture!)
- 1 cup strawberries – sliced, fresh and vibrant for that fruity sweetness
- 1/2 cup raspberry sauce, homemade or store-bought for a tangy kick
- Mint leaves – for garnish, adding a pop of color and freshness
How to Prepare Instructions
Getting ready to create this stunning dessert is easier than you might think! Just foll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a beautiful plate of sweetness in no time.
- First, slice your chocolate cake into even pieces. I usually aim for about 1-inch thick slices for the perfect balance of cake and toppings.
- Next, grab a plate and place a slice of cake right in the center. This is your canvas, so make sure it’s looking nice!
- Now, it’s time for the magic! Spread a generous layer of whipped cream on top of the cake. I like to use a small spatula to get it nice and smooth—just like frosting a cake!
- Then, add the sliced strawberries on top of the whipped cream. Don’t be shy—pile them on for that fresh, vibrant look!
- Drizzle your raspberry sauce over the strawberries. This adds a beautiful contrast and a sweet-tart flavor that pairs perfectly with the chocolate.
- Finally, garnish with a few mint leaves to add a touch of elegance and freshness. They really make the plate pop!

Tips for Success
To make sure your dessert plating turns out absolutely fabulous, here are some of my top tips that I swear by:
- Use fresh strawberries: Trust me, fresh strawberries make all the difference in flavor and presentation. Look for ones that are bright red and firm for the best taste!
- Chill the whipped cream: For that perfect, fluffy texture, make sure your whipped cream is well-chilled before using it. I like to put it in the fridge for at least 30 minutes before I need it.
- Serve immediately: This dessert is best enjoyed fresh! The whipped cream and strawberries are at their peak right after plating, so try to serve it right away to your special someone.
- Experiment with plating: Don’t be afraid to play around with how you arrange the fruit and sauce. A little creativity can go a long way, and it’s all about what looks good to you!
- Use a squeeze bottle for sauce: If you have one, use a squeeze bottle for the raspberry sauce. It allows you to drizzle with precision, making your plating even more beautiful!
- Keep it simple: Sometimes less is more. A few well-placed strawberries and a drizzle of sauce can create a stunning visual effect without overwhelming the plate.

FAQ Section
Can I use a different type of cake?
Absolutely! While chocolate cake is a classic choice, you can use vanilla, red velvet, or even a flourless chocolate cake for a gluten-free option. Just make sure it complements the toppings!
How should I store leftovers?
If you happen to have any leftovers (which is rare, trust me!), store the components separately in the fridge. Keep the cake in an airtight container and the whipped cream and fruit in their own containers. This way, everything stays fresh!
Can I make this in advance?
You can prepare the chocolate cake a day ahead and keep it wrapped tightly in the fridge. However, I recommend waiting to plate the dessert until just before serving to keep the whipped cream and fruit looking their best!
What if I don’t have raspberry sauce?
No worries! If you don’t have raspberry sauce, you can easily substitute with strawberry sauce, chocolate sauce, or even a simple dusting of powdered sugar. Get creative with what you have on hand!
How many servings does this recipe make?
This recipe yields about 2 servings. If you’re hosting a romantic dinner for two, it’s perfect! But feel free to double or triple the recipe for larger gatherings.
Can I use frozen strawberries?
While fresh strawberries are best for flavor and texture, you can use frozen strawberries in a pinch. Just be sure to thaw and drain them before using to avoid excess moisture on your plate!
Is this dessert suitable for vegetarians?
Yes! This dessert is completely vegetarian-friendly. Just check that your chocolate cake recipe doesn’t include any animal-derived ingredients if you’re being strict about it.
Can I prepare the whipped cream ahead of time?
You can whip the cream ahead of time and store it in the fridge for a few hours. Just give it a gentle stir before using, as it can thicken up a bit!
